Millennial Lithium Appoints Iain Scarr VP of Exploration and Development
Millennial Lithium Corp. has appointed Iain Scarr as vice president of exploration and development.
Iain Scarr has worked primarily in industrial minerals exploration and commercial development since 1979. During his career with Rio Tinto, he was responsible for multiple discoveries in North and South America and Africa, and worked on the commercial justification for the Jadar lithium-borate resource in Serbia. He graduated with a B.Sc. in geology from California State University, and earned an MBA from The University of Southern California.
Following his 29 years with Rio Tinto, Scarr incorporated IMEx Consultants and with a group of partners formed IMEx Minerals Inc. He then joined Lithium One Inc. where he was responsible for bringing the Sal de Vida lithium Brine project in Argentina through feasibility with Galaxy Resources, and more recently the Rincon project with Enirgi. During his time working on these world-class resources, Scarr established relationships with globally respected professionals from multiple disciplines world-wide.
Scarr brings the expertise needed in the development and commercialization of mineral deposits, particularly lithium brine deposits in the “Lithium Triangle” of South America.
